My submission for item 18: An RAF airfield – Must have been last used for any flying activities on/before 31/12/1949 - built 1940, closed 1947
I claim a bonus point as the original Control Tower building still exists, Taken Sunday 09/08/2020 at 0805 400 yards north of Moyles Court School, Ringwood BH24 3NF
Farmland requisitioned fir an airfield, concrete runways laid over rubble from the Southampton blitz. The airfield and some of the real-life pilots appeared in the wartime propaganda film “The First of the Few”.
Closed at the end of the war and taken up by a local car club. The perimeter track was, unusually for a race circuit. run anticlockwise. It attracted drivers of the calibre of Roy Salvadori, Cokin Chapman and Mike Hawthorn. The land was stripped for gravel when the circuit clsed; the resulting lakes include a nature reserve and a watersports area.
